HORNETS FLAGSHIP RADIO DIALS CHANGE TO
KMEZ 106.7 FM AND WCDV 103.3 FM
The New Orleans Hornets announced today that the Hornets flagship station in New Orleans will change radio dials to 100,000 watt KMEZ 106.7 FM (formerly 102.9 FM) and the Baton Rouge flagship station will now be 100,000 watt WCDV 103.3 FM.
The team has also signed agreements with 18 other radio stations across the states of Louisiana and Mississippi to broadcast Hornets games for the 2008-09 season.
Fans in New Orleans can catch all home and away pre-season, regular season and post-season games on the flagship station KMEZ 106.7 FM and in Baton Rouge on WCDV 103.3 FM.
For the first time ever, Hornets home games will also be broadcast in Spanish on WFNO 830 AM in New Orleans and WPYR 1380 AM in Baton Rouge.
The broadcast team is anchored by Sean Kelley, who will begin his fourth season as the team’s play-by-play voice. Veteran color analyst Gerry Vaillancourt starts his 19th season with the Hornets and will sit next to Kelley. Joe Block returns for his second season as studio host and will host all pre-game and post-game radio shows. The “Hornets OT” post-game show will broadcast live from Ernst Café directly following Hornets home games.
“Hornets Sportsline” with Gerry V will start on Thursday, Oct. 2 and will air every Thursday from 7-8 p.m. throughout the season on KMEZ 106.7 FM and WCDV 103.3 FM and on most affiliate stations.
